Synthesis and antibacterial performance of size-tunable silver nanoparticles with electrospun nanofiber composites

A simple one-step method using by P-cyclodextrin (beta-CD) and polyacrylonitrile (PAN) solution was used for preparing electrospun nanofiber (NF) composites containing silver nanoparticles by electrospinning. The beta-CD acted as a stabilizing and reducing agent for the formation of silver nanoparticles. In addition, the average size of the silver nanoparticles could be tuned by changing the concentration of beta-CD. The surface and pore properties were characterized by scanning electron microscopy (SEM), transmission electron microscopy (TEM), X-ray photoelectronic spectroscopy (XPS), and Brunauer-Emmett-Teller (BET) measurements. The antimicrobial activities of NFs containing silver nanoparticles (Ag/NFs) against Escherichia coli (E. coli) and Staphylococcus epidermidis (S. epidermidis) were evaluated by optical density testing.
